Date: 2011-09-05 11:24 am (UTC)The priest reminded me of Father Theo in appearance but doesn't seem to have the great humon that Father Theo had. NOr the great faith. I suppose it is no coincidence that the priests look like priests are 'supposed' to look.
Lochley had aged a bit but then don't we all. I liked her determination and found it to be very much in character for her. She'd have made a good detective.
